
Silkie
The Silkie is a truly unique and endearing chicken breed, renowned for its distinctive appearance and gentle temperament. This small to medium-sized breed is easily identifiable by its fluffy plumage, which resembles silk or satin due to the lack of barbicels in their feathers, giving them a soft, fur-like texture. The Silkie's feathering extends down its legs, contributing to its charmingly cuddly look. Typically black, white, blue, or partridge in color, Silkies possess a striking appearance highlighted by their dark skin, bones, and earlobes—generally a deep blue, which sharply contrasts with their light feathers.
The Silkie is not just a visual delight; these chickens are cherished for their friendly and docile nature, making them excellent pets, especially for families and children. They are known to be good brooder hens, often eager to incubate eggs and raise chicks, regardless of the species. Silkie roosters are also known for their mellow demeanor compared to other breeds. While they are not high egg producers, laying small, cream-colored eggs, Silkies are loved more for their companionship and ornamental value than for their utility. Their calm disposition and quirky appearance make them a wonderful addition to backyard flocks where companionship and aesthetics are valued.
